Product Description:
The FVCA01.2-4K00-3P4-MDA-LP-NNNN-02VRS is a member of the FVCA Frequency Converters series produced by Bosch Rexroth Indramat. As a variable-speed drive, it converts fixed three-phase mains into a regulated frequency and voltage output so induction or synchronous machines can be matched to process demands. The unit supports V/f scalar control, sensorless vector control, and field-oriented control through space-vector PWM, allowing deployment in assembly lines, material-handling conveyors, and HVAC fans where consistent torque at low speed is required.
It delivers an apparent power of 6.5 kVA and accepts a nominal input of 400 V, operating within a 3 AC 380 to 480 V supply window with a -15% to +10% tolerance. The inverter can provide up to 4.0 kW of output power and draws 16 A on the line side. Switching devices operate at a factory-set carrier of 8.0 kHz, balancing acoustic performance and thermal load. Frequency references from the keypad, ModBus, or the onboard potentiometer are resolved to 0.01 Hz, enabling fine speed trimming during closed-loop PID operation. A built-in brake chopper works with an external resistor for rapid deceleration, and the Class C3 input filter limits conducted emissions. The B-frame housing measures 150 mm by 157 mm by 330 mm and mounts with four M6 screws.
At cold start, the field-oriented algorithm can generate torque of 200% at 0 Hz, letting lifting or tensioning axes move without a gearbox. When an analog speed command is used, regulation holds within 0.05%, supporting precise web handling or metering pumps. The power stage feeds the output terminals and energizes a form-C relay rated at 230 VAC / 30 VDC / 3 A for status signaling to external safety interlocks. Advanced SVPWM, autotuning, and multi-level protection functions are available through the LCD menu.
